Privacy Policy for Oracle Health Care
Oracle Health Care is committed to respecting the privacy of every individual who shares information or data with us. Protecting your privacy is our priority, and we strive to ensure that your data is handled with care and in compliance with applicable laws, including
- The Information Technology Act, 2000 – Section 43A
- The Information Technology (Reasonable Security Practices and Procedures and Sensitive Personal Information) Rules, 2011
- Applicable guidelines issued by the Reserve Bank of India (RBI) for online payments
- Payment Card Industry Data Security Standards (PCI DSS)
This Privacy Policy outlines how Oracle Health Care collects, stores, processes, discloses and transfers your Personal Information when you use our website, www.oraclehealthcare.in (“Website”), its subdomains, and services offered therein (“Services”).
By accessing or using our Website or Services, you agree to the terms and practices described in this Privacy Policy.
